Description

  • A GOOD SPANISH CHESTNUT CHEST OF DRAWERS, CARLOS II
  • 125 cm wide, 55 cm deep, 92 cm high
the rectangular top, above two generous drawers with hand made iron escutcheons on square block feet

Provenance

from the collection of Jose Maria del Rey, Madrid

Condition

good some areas of wear to feet over all wear consistent with age
